    AVATAR | Release New Single Feat. LZZY HALE ‘Violence No Matter What.

    Photo Credit: Pierre Veillet

    The heavy metal, dark, madcap visionaries, collectively known as AVATAR, have emerged from deep within the Swedish forest in which they have been working on their ninth studio album, Dance Devil Dance, due for release 17th February 2023 via Black Waltz Records.

    They’ve released a brand new single and official lyric video for ‘Violence No Matter What’, which features a duet with HALESTORM‘s Lzzy Hale.

     

    “one thing and one thing only. It’s ok to debate and fight and to think differently. But there is a limit, and the line must be drawn at authority held with violence, a world view that cannot survive without enemies, a promised return to a fabricated former glory” says Front man Johannes Eckerström.

    “Was such an inspiring piece to be a part of! Thank you so much to the boys for giving me the opportunity to express my angst against the horrors of this world through such a brilliant song.” says HALESTORM‘s vocalist Lzzy Hale.

    AVATAR hit the UK on a string of headline shows in February 2023, with support from Mastiff and Veil of Maya.

    AVATAR are:
    Johannes Eckerström – vocals
    Jonas Jarlsby – guitars
    Tim Öhrström – guitars
    Henrik Sandelin – bass
    John Alfredsson – drums
